Traeger Pulled Pork

PREPARATION

1. Trim off any loose fat and skin on the shoulder.
2. Rub the shoulder with Frenchs Yellow Mustard.
3. Lightly rub Traeger Sweet Rub and Traeger BBQ Rub (1/2 and 1/2) into the shoulder and mustard.
4. Set the grill at 220 degrees F.
5. Cook the roast until the internal temperature reaches 195 degrees F, approximately 1 to 1 ½ hour per pound.
6. Wrap in foil and hold for 2 hours.
7. Remove from foil and shred the meat with a fork or with your fingers.
8. Place shredded pork into a serving tray.
9. Mix one part Traeger BBQ sauce, one part Traeger Apricot sauce and 1/3 part Mandarin glaze.

Recommended pellets: 1/3 Onion & 2/3 Hickory pellets
